Analog to Digital Converters (ADC) Analog Devices, Inc. MAX132CWG+ Overview

The MAX132CWG+ from Analog Devices, Inc. is a high-precision 18-bit Analog to Digital Converter (ADC) designed for sophisticated electronic measuring applications that require high accuracy and low noise. As part of the Analog to Digital Converters (ADC) category, this component offers advanced multislope conversion technology housed in a 24-SOIC package, ensuring reliable performance in a compact form. Its versatility makes it ideal for demanding environments where precision is crucial, helping businesses scale their operations efficiently by integrating cutting-edge technology into their systems.

MAX132CWG+ Features

This ADC is known for its exceptional resolution and accuracy, featuring an 18-bit multislope conversion process that minimizes noise and maximizes signal integrity. The MAX132CWG+ operates over a broad voltage range, making it suitable for a variety of industrial and commercial applications. Its low power consumption and high-speed operation facilitate seamless integration into existing product lines, enhancing performance without compromising on efficiency.
